Moving from a grocer’s ethnic door to the ice cream door is where the company wants to be. But, as an executive notes, “It’s a lot more crowded in the ice cream door.”
Ramar Foods started out serving Asian groceries. Now, after repositioning its Magnolia ice cream brand, the California processor is picking up mainstream retailers. Yet the third-generation management stays true to its Filipino roots.
